Elle Woods, a bubbly sorority girl known for her love of pink and all things fashion, isn't taken seriously. But when her boyfriend Warner dumps her to attend Harvard Law, Elle sets out to prove him wrong. In a move that surprises everyone (including herself!), Elle gets accepted to Harvard Law too.
Legally Blonde: The Musical isn't just about Elle conquering the prestigious halls of Harvard. It's a hilarious and heartwarming journey of self-discovery. Elle uses her underestimated strengths - her knowledge of fashion, unwavering positivity, and a knack for spotting details others miss - to not only succeed but also win over her classmates and even a tough legal case. With catchy pop tunes like "Omigod You Guys" and "So Much Better," the musical celebrates Elle's journey from underestimated blonde to a brilliant lawyer who proves you can be both stylish and intelligent.
